This is the Musical The Prince of Tennis - Absolute King Rikkai feat. Rokkaku - Second Service report book released by Kizaki Ayano (Siegessaule) on 18 August 2007. It obviously contains spoilers to the musical, so proceed with caution.

The SanaYuki duet. The bits of lyrics I managed to catch was Yuki singing he was going to have the operation, for the sake of the future, and Sanada was going to have his match, for the future. It was the sort of song that said "I'm doing this for you and I have you in my heart and I no longer feel confused or lost, please wait for me,my dear husband."
Fuu rin ka san - possibly the funniest song in Tenimyu history. Sanada got on the raised stage, the screen behind him started playing some fire and wind effects, and the rest of Rikkai danced in front of him. Renji stood at the front at first, explaining what Fuu rin ka san meant, and then they all danced together. There was a lot of posing and hip rotation involved. Kento failed at hip rotation.
